Sustainable Home Remedies for Healthy Weight Loss: An Ayurvedic Perspective
Ayurveda offers a holistic approach to weight management, focusing on check here achieving balance within the body. Rather than relying solely on restrictive diets or quick fixes, Ayurvedic principles emphasize balancing the body with wholesome foods and practices that promote inner peace. Incorporating certain home remedies into your daily routine can effectively support sustainable weight loss by {boostingdigestion, reducing cravings, and promoting healthy digestion.
One effective remedy is to consume warm water with a squeeze of lemon first thing in the morning. This aids to remove toxins from the body, stimulate metabolism, and reduce bloating.
Another beneficial practice is regular exercise, preferably outdoors in nature. Ayurveda promotes activities like yoga, walking, and swimming, as these practices not only tone the body but also manage stress levels, which can contribute to weight gain.
A third powerful home remedy is preparing herbal teas like ginger or cinnamon. These spices have been traditionally used in Ayurveda for their metabolism-boosting properties.
By embracing these simple yet effective home remedies into your daily routine, you can start a journey towards sustainable weight loss and improved overall well-being from an Ayurvedic perspective. Remember that consistency is key, and patience is essential for lasting results.
Harnessing Ayurveda: Simple Home Remedies for Weight Reduction
Ayurveda, a traditional Indian system of medicine, offers effective approaches to weight management. Incorporating easy home remedies into your daily routine can aid in your journey towards achieving a healthy weight.
One Ayurvedic principle is balancing the three doshas: Vata, Pitta, and Kapha. These doshas play a distinct role in your body's processes.
By understanding your predominant dosha, you can tailor your diet and lifestyle to facilitate weight loss. Let us say, if you have a Vata strong tendency, consuming warm, grounding foods like stews can be helpful.
A few common Ayurvedic remedies for weight reduction include:
* Lemonade with a pinch of turmeric first thing in the morning to boost your metabolism.
* Incorporating cinnamon into your daily diet to aid digestion.
* Practicing yoga regularly to reduce stress, which can consequently help with weight management.
Remember, Ayurveda is about overall well-being. By implementing subtle changes in your lifestyle and incorporating these simple home remedies, you can work towards a healthier weight and overall wellness.
